Pakistan, India agree to immediate ceasefire, confirms PM Shehbaz​


PM Shehbaz Sharif to address the nation soon to provide full details of the agreement

News Desk
May 10, 2025

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if has confirmed that both Pakistan and India have agreed to an immediate ceasefire, as the two nuclear-armed neighbours came dangerously close to catastrophic conflict following series of escalating events that pushed the region to the brink of war.

The situation further escalated between Pakistan and India last night when India carried out airstrikes on three Pakistan Air Force (PAF) bases: Nur Khan, Murid, and Shorkot. In response, Pakistan launched a retaliatory military operation named ‘Bunyan-un-Marsoos’ against the ongoing Indian aggression.

Pakistan deployed its Al-Fatah missile and targeted multiple Indian military installations and airbases that were being used to launch attacks on Pakistan. India’s Akhnoor Aviation Base, Bathinda Airfield, and Sirsa Airfield were reportedly destroyed.

Additionally, Pakistan destroyed a BrahMos missile storage site in the Beas area, while Pakistan Air Force’s JF-17 Thunder jets eliminated India’s S-400 air defence system stationed in Adampur using hypersonic missiles.

Speaking to Express News in an exclusive interview, Prime Minister Sharif said he would address the nation soon to provide full details of the agreement.

“I will share all the details in my address to the nation,” PM Shehbaz said
